Bowlers are on the way up

CUMBERNAULD indoor bowlers have notched up a double success this year.

Both the gents and the seniors have topped their respective leagues.

The gents won nine out of ten games during the season and clinched the SIBA Division 2, Section B league tite with four points to spare and will now be playing in the First Division of the Scottish League next season.

During their successful season the squad have journeyed around the country to places such as Hawick, Dunfermline, East Kilbride, Fintry and Milngavie.

A club spokesman said: “Our team has a blend of youth and experience which has paid off thi season and we hope to be challenging for the First Division title next season.”

Cumbernauld played their last league game of the season against Teviotdale last Saturday and came out 85-74 winners. The results were: Gary Wilson, 21-20; Dougie Geal, 21-21; Paul Simpson, 19-16 and Jim Byron, 24-17.

The gents still have the Scottish Cup to contend with and are due to face Ardrossan at Paisley IBC on Saturday, February 12. Ardrossan will be a tough nut to crack but the local side are quite confident that they will come out on top.

The club’s second unfolded last Saturday when the senior team (over 60s) were crowned Scottish Seniors League West B champions when they beat Blantyre seniors by eight shots, 70-62. They now progress to the play-offs which take place at Paisley IBC on February 5.
